Lotus Vale
I have never seen so much confusion on Gatherer over single card

http://gatherer.wizards.com/Pages/Card/Discussion.aspx?multiverseid=4593

So I decided to make this thread.

1. Original text on card is obsolete. Oracle/gatherer text is more accurate.

2. The actual effect of sacrificing lands is not Trigerred ability, but replacement effect, which replaces playing a land. Very unusual.

Because there is no way how to react on playing a land there is no way how to react on this specific replacement effect. Therefore it cannot be Stifled, or otherwise countered.

3. Once land is sacrificed it cannot be tapped anymore.
4. If you tap a land you cannot sacrifice it to Lotus Vale anymore because its not untapped as the effect requires.

1) You attempt to play lotus vale
2) You decide to pay the 'cost of entry' for it to come into play or not (sacrifice two untapped lands)
3) If you did sacrifice two lands, you get lotus vale. If you didn't it NEVER enters play
4) Once that sequence is done, then and only then can it be tapped for mana or become the target for vindicate (as according to the rules for priority and what have you)

This card functions as Mox diamond now does, except in land form. It is a much more common card, so perhaps watching rulings for that will help you understand.

To clarify there is no opportunity for you to tap it for mana or for your opponent to vindicate it between you announcement of Lotus vale and you sacrificing lands/putting vale to the graveyard.

Can you sacrifice City of Traitors as one of your lands to Lotus Vale (or Scorched Ruins)?

Can you sacrifice City of Traitors as one of your lands to Lotus Vale (or Scorched Ruins)?

You can regardless of the rule offler quoted. City of Traitors simply has a triggered ability which goes on the stack after the other land has come into play. It triggers as soon as you play the other land, but it can't even go on the stack until after the vale's ability is finished resolving.

City of Traitors will trigger when you play Lotus Vale, regardless of whether you chose to sacrifice two untapped lands or not. In either case, you took the action of playing a land and that's what City of Traitors cares about. It doesn't matter that a replacement effect turns the action into something else.
